Slewing bearings comprise an inner ring and an outer ring, one of which usually incorporates a gear. Together with attachment holes in both rings, they enable an optimized power transmission with a simple and quick connection between adjacent machine components. The bearing raceways, in conjunction with the rolling elements and cages or spacers, are designed to accommodate loads acting singly or in combination, and in any direction.
